Kusy Posted September 9, 2011 Share Posted September 9, 2011 My comments are never good.This doesn't look too good at all, the screen is literally cluttered, I can't even read what the first of two blue signs is saying, there are too many gray and blue colors on the above ground level, while everything is clear and fine underground - the above blends into one pulp.This was written before you made those signs red… now the background blends into one pulp while the signs hurt my eyes badly. You should try to make different parts of that well... more different in tone and color.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...

Jeff Posted September 9, 2011 Share Posted September 9, 2011 There's too much happening. Simplify the graphics/mapping a bit. Maybe when it's on a bigger screen it'll look better, but right now it's hard to get what's going on. I'd also suggest outlining people somehow, right now they don't stand out much. Maybe just use bright shirt colors or something, anything to make them stand out.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...

Kusy Posted September 11, 2011 Share Posted September 11, 2011 Not sure if you could do that, but how about making the outlines a zone specific thing? So when a player walks into a dark corridor the outline around his character is white, while walking into a well lit room would turn it let's say, intensive blue or something.
